Role Description

As a Senior Product Manager in the Communications Platform, you will enable teams across Dropbox to deliver impactful in-app campaigns, emails, and notifications that drive revenue, engagement, and user satisfaction. You will shape the roadmap for a platform that supports all lines of business—including our core products, standalone offerings, and AI-first initiatives like Dash—balancing innovation and foundational improvements to scale tools used to reach hundreds of millions of users.

In this role, you’ll identify opportunities to enhance platform functionality, measure the effectiveness of campaigns, and prioritize features that empower teams to execute data-driven strategies. By evaluating current tools and addressing gaps, you’ll deliver a scalable, reliable, and business-critical platform. This is a high-impact opportunity to collaborate with senior leaders, work cross-functionally across business units, and drive meaningful outcomes for Dropbox and its users.

What you need to know about the Toronto Tech Scene

Although home to some of the biggest names in tech, including Google, Microsoft and Amazon, Toronto has established itself as one of the largest startup ecosystems in the world. And with over 2,000 startups — more than 30 percent of the country's total startups — Toronto continues to attract new businesses. Be it helping entrepreneurs manage their finances, simplifying business operations by automating payroll or assisting pharmaceutical companies in launching new drugs, the city's tech scene is just getting started.
